The heat and humidity has been helping to pop up spotty showers and thundestorms lately during the afternoons and evenings. We'll have more of those "splash n' dash" storms again on Friday. These storms really aren't too worrisome, just go inside if you hear the thunder. Different story on Saturday however. A cold front will move through Kentuckiana late Saturday afternoon and evening. Some cold air high in the sky will also tag along, providing more instability. So, we'll really have to watch Saturday closely for some organized severe weather. The main threat will be large hail (due to the cold air up top), and damaging straight-line winds. If you have any outdoor plans Saturday, try to fit them in early.
